Google (Nasdaq: GOOG) has launched a 411 directory look-up service. According to Tech Crunch, it works fairly well.
The phone companies including Verizon (NYSE: VZ) and AT&T (NYSE: T) don't need another online competitor to take away a nice profit center. VoIP is already killing their profitable landline service. A good 411 product could take away another nice piece of revenue.
Verizon is still at the early stages of selling its fiber to the home service in the hopes of getting TV customers away from cable. And, AT&T is even further behind.
